Step 1: grease the form pan (Ø 28cm) and powder it with a bit of flour. Preheat the oven to 200° ( Circulating Air: 180°). Defrost the spinach.
Step 2: knead the flour with butter, salt and the egg. Powder your countertop with some flour. Roll out the dough until it‘s a bit larger than your form pan. Put the dough in the form pan and press it to the frame of the pan to create the rim. You can cut the rest of the dough that protrudes the form pan. Now put the dough in the preheatead oven for about 10 minutes.
Step 3: dice the onion and the feta cheese in cubes. Put the defreezed spinach in the form pan and put the onion and feta cubes on top. Mix the egg with cream, sour cream and the cheese. If you want you can flavour them with salt, pepper and nutmeg.
Now pour the mixture over the dough, the spinach and the onion/feta cubes. You still should see the rim of the dough. Place pine nuts on top. Now bake the quiche for another 30 minutes in the preheated oven.
Ready to eat!
